There was a constant stream of 18 wheelers coming and going and the drivers ordering their favorite meals. One driver we talked with suggested we try the butter chicken. We did, and it was amazing. We also ordered the lamb korma, and it too was amazing. Both meals included regular or garlic naan at no extra charge and a very simple and refreshing salad of cucumbers, red onion, and shredded cabbage with a light seasoning. Yum! And the quantity of each meal was enough for two meals from each dish.
There were places to sit outside to enjoy your meal, which we did. There is also an inside dining area that has small booths located inside a converted shipping container. Electronic payment was fast and simple, and the person taking the order was very pleasant and professional.
So, if you’re hungry for Indian food and in Biggs Junction Oregon, take the time to stop here for a great meal. No, you won’t find fancy linens, waiters in white coats, or an elegant dining room setting. It’s just amazing food that confirms the old saying that, at least in this case, truck drivers do indeed know where the best places to eat are located.
Tandoori Hut is located on old route 30, just east of the main intersection in Biggs, and on the river side of the road. Just look for all the truckers parked along the road.
